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ations And Comparisons
When choosing LDPE foam for packaging or projects, consider the following factors to ensure you select a product that meets your protection, customization, and durability needs.
- Density and cushioning level: LDPE foam varies in density. Higher density (HDPE) generally offers greater impact protection and shape retention, which is important for electronics and delicate instruments. For light-duty packing, lower density sheets may suffice and are easier to cut.
- Thickness and sheet size: Thicker sheets provide more padding per layer but can add bulk. Choose thickness and panel size based on item dimensions, case depth, and the number of layers needed for safe transit.
- Cutting and customization: Your ability to cut out precise shapes affects how well inserts fit around irregular items. Look for foams marketed as “pick & pluck” or easily moldable with common tools like a sharp knife or electric knife.
- Moisture resistance and durability: LDPE foam typically offers good moisture resistance due to its closed-cell structure. This helps protect items from humidity and minor spills during storage or travel.
- Reusability and longevity: For repeated packing or long-term storage, durability matters. Consider sheets intended for multiple uses and even seasonal crafting projects.
- Color and finish: Black sheets are common for tool cases and equipment, while clear or neutral tones can be preferable for crafts where visibility of contents is important.
- Size variety: A mix of sheet sizes (e.g., 16 x 12 inches and larger packs) supports both small-scale inserts and larger case padding. Select a combination that aligns with your typical product dimensions.
- Price vs. quantity: Quantities such as 2-pack sheets offer convenience and value for frequent projects. Compare per-square-foot cost to determine long-term cost effectiveness.
- Compatibility with other materials: If you already use foam around electronics or instruments, ensure the LDPE foam is compatible with adhesives, liners, or other padding elements in your setup.
